Men's Soccer Wins Exhibition At Presbyterian

CLINTON, S.C. - On Thursday afternoon, the Wofford men's soccer team defeated Presbyterian College 3-0 in an exhibition contest. The game was originally scheduled for Wednesday in Spartanburg, but was postponed due to rain.

In the first of three 30 minute periods, Wofford scored three goals all in the first 15 minutes. Carlos Dominguez Gonzalez opened the scoring with a header that beat Presbyterian starting goal keeper Tyler Beadle.  Alex Hutchins headed home a corner from Carlos Dominguez Gonzalez to give the Terriers a 2-0 lead.  Forrest Lasso added the final score on a header from a long throw in by Billy Padula.  Neither team was able to add goals in the second or third period of the game. 

Andrew Drennan started the game in goal, played 60 minutes, and recorded two saves.  Mike Nichols played the last 30 minute period and helped to preserve the 3-0 shutout win.

Wofford will travel to Clemson on Saturday for an exhibition game at 7:00 p.m. The regular season begins on August 25 at Wake Forest.
